Wireless sensor networks commonly consist of a large number of tiny sensor nodes that are deployed either inside the target area or very close to it to cooperatively monitor the target area. Energy efficiency and network lifetime are two challenges that most of researchers deal with. In this paper, to improve the performance of sensor networks, we propose an energy-efficient competitive clustering algorithm for wireless sensor networks using a controlled mobile sink. Clustering algorithm can effectively organize sensor nodes and the use of a controlled mobile sink node can mitigate hot spot problem or energy holes. The selection of optimal moving trajectory for sink nodes is an NP-hard problem. In our algorithm, we firstly study an competitive clustering algorithm in which cluster heads are rotated in each round and selected mainly based on their competition range and their residual energy. Besides, we use mobile sink node instead of fixed sink node. The mobile sink node moves at a certain speed along a predefined path and sojourn at some park position to collect data packets. Simulation results validate that competitive clustering algorithm outperforms LEACH and the use of mobile sink node significantly improve the performance of the sensor network.
